The ESPN Pac12 blog has run some stats on returning offensive yards and it's pretty eye opening to see exactly how little is coming back next year for Stanford:
Receiving:
Percentage of yards returning: 17 percent
Percentage of catches returning: 23 percent
Percentage of touchdowns returning: 5 percent
Rushing:
Percentage of yards returning: 33 percent
Percentage of attempts returning: 31 percent
Percentage of touchdowns returning: 30 percent
Most teams appear to be returning in the 50s to 80s on those areas. I wonder how correlative returning rush and receiving yards is to success vs. returning OLine starts or defensive starts.
